The Hotel New Hampshire takes a look at quirky Americana and
the ultimate dysfunctional family.
The Berrys are headed by patriarch Mr. Win Berry (Beau Bridges), who has never
been a successful man but has always been an entrepreneur at heart. With his wife
(Lisa Banes), he has a created a large family with many children,
none of whom are the least bit normal.
John (Rob Lowe) is the athletic football player and womanizer with a deep-rooted
desire for his own sister Frannie (Jodie Foster), a victim of a gang rape, now morbidly
fascinated by one of the rapists, and equally attracted to her brother with incestuous
desire. Frank (Paul McCrane) is their gay younger brother; and Lilly (Jennifer
Dundas) is the little sister who blossoms into a famous author. Associated with the
family is Suzie the Bear (Nastassja Kinski) who is not secure enough to come out of
her bear suit. A friend of the family, Freud (Wallace Shawn), who has been blinded
by the Nazis, runs the Hotel New Hampshire in Vienna. In need of help, he asks the
family to come to his aid...
Fireworks ensue in this outrageous adult fairy tale directed by Tony Richardson
(Look Back in Anger, The Charge of the Light Brigade) and based on a novel by
John Irving, writer of The Cider House Rules and The World According to Garp.
